Sodium Thiocyanate
INCI: SODIUM THIOCYANATE
Sodium thiocyanate is a synthetic preservative booster with limited safety data; it may cause irritation for sensitive skin and is best avoided in leave-on products.
In plain English
Sodium thiocyanate is a man-made salt that helps preserve cosmetic products by preventing the growth of microbes. It is sometimes added to boost the effectiveness of other preservatives. However, it has limited safety research in skincare, and some studies suggest it can be irritating, especially for people with sensitive skin or thyroid conditions. Because of these concerns, it is more commonly found in rinse-off products like shampoos rather than leave-on creams or serums.

What it is
Sodium thiocyanate is the sodium salt of thiocyanic acid, a synthetic compound used in cosmetics as a preservative enhancer and stabilizer. It is not naturally derived and is produced through chemical synthesis.
How it works
In a cosmetic formula, sodium thiocyanate works by disrupting the cell membranes of bacteria and fungi, helping to prevent spoilage. It is often used in combination with other preservatives to lower the total preservative concentration needed, which can reduce irritation potential of the overall system. However, its own safety profile is less established than more common preservatives.

Safety summary
Sodium thiocyanate has limited safety data in cosmetics. It can cause skin irritation and may interfere with thyroid function if absorbed in significant amounts. It is generally considered safer in rinse-off products at low concentrations, but sensitive individuals and those with thyroid issues should exercise caution.
Research notes
Most available research on sodium thiocyanate focuses on industrial or medical contexts, not cosmetic use. There are no large-scale human studies on its safety in skincare. The Cosmetic Ingredient Review has not published a monograph on this ingredient, so evidence is considered emerging.
Common label clues
- Typical concentration
- Typically used at very low levels, often below 1%
- Regulatory status
- Sodium thiocyanate is not specifically restricted by the FDA for cosmetics, but it is not widely reviewed by safety panels like the Cosmetic Ingredient Review (CIR). Its use is generally accepted at low concentrations in rinse-off products.
- Common uses
- Rinse-off products like shampoos and cleansers, Hair care formulations
- Environmental note
- Sodium thiocyanate is synthetic and may persist in water systems; its environmental impact is not well studied.
Good to know
- Sodium thiocyanate is not a primary preservative but is often used as a 'booster' to support other preservatives.
- It is more common in professional or salon hair products than in everyday skincare.
